And if you're interested in the Feri tradition, the book to read is Evolutionary Witchcraft by T. Thorn Coyle. The tradition that Feri is closest to that people have actually heard of is Starhawk's Reclaiming, except that the focus in Feri is more on improving the self so as to be a more positive force in the world, as opposed to Starhawk's greater emphasis on direct activism.
